Alessandra Calabrese
About
Alessandra Calabrese has authored 26 papers that have received a total of 1.1k indexed citations.
This includes 20 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Genetics and 5 papers in Surgery. The topics of these papers are Connexins and lens biology (10 papers), Pancreatic Islet Dysfunction and Regeneration (5 papers) and BRCA gene mutations in cancer (5 papers). Alessandra Calabrese is often cited by papers focused on Connexins and lens biology (10 papers), Pancreatic Islet Dysfunction and Regeneration (5 papers) and BRCA gene mutations in cancer (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Switzerland and United States. Alessandra Calabrese's co-authors include Paolo Meda, David Caton, Véronique Serre‐Beinier, Francesco Salvatore and Valeria D’Argenio and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Journal of Clinical Investigation and Molecular and Cellular Biology.
